(+/-)-3,7-Dimethyloct-6-en-1-ol Chemical Properties

IUPAC Name: 3,7-Dimethyloct-6-en-1-ol
Synonyms of (+/-)-3,7-Dimethyloct-6-en-1-ol (CAS NO.26489-01-0): 6-Octen-1-ol, 3,7-dimethyl-, (+-)- ; Citronellol, (+-)- ; (1)-3,7-Dimethyloct-6-en-1-ol
CAS NO: 26489-01-0
Molecular Formula:C10H20O
Molecular Weight: 156.27
Molecular Structure:
EINECS: 203-375-0
H bond acceptors: 1
H bond donors: 1
Freely Rotating Bonds: 6
Polar Surface Area: 20.23 Å2
Index of Refraction: 1.45
Molar Refractivity: 49.77 cm3
Molar Volume: 184.9 cm3
Surface Tension: 28.5 dyne/cm
Density: 0.845 g/cm3
Flash Point: 98.3 °C 
Melting Point: 77-83 °C(lit.)
Storage temp: 2-8°C
Enthalpy of Vaporization: 53.6 kJ/mol
Boiling Point: 224.5 °C at 760 mmHg
Vapour Pressure: 0.0183 mmHg at 25°C
SMILES: C\C(C)=C\CCC(C)CCO
InChI: InChI=1/C10H20O/c1-9(2)5-4-6-10(3)7-8-11/h5,10-11H,4,6-8H2,1-3H3
InChIKey: QMVPMAAFGQKVCJ-UHFFFAOYAO
Std. InChI: InChI=1S/C10H20O/c1-9(2)5-4-6-10(3)7-8-11/h5,10-11H,4,6-8H2,1-3H3
Std. InChIKey: QMVPMAAFGQKVCJ-UHFFFAOYSA-N  

(+/-)-3,7-Dimethyloct-6-en-1-ol Safety Profile

Hazard Codes: IrritantXi
Risk Statements: 36/37/38
R36/37/38: Irritating to eyes, respiratory system and skin.
Safety Statements: 26-36
S26: In case of contact with eyes, rinse immediately with plenty of water and seek medical advice. 
S36: Wear suitable protective clothing.
WGK Germany: 1
RTECS: RH3400000

(+/-)-3,7-Dimethyloct-6-en-1-ol Specification

General Information: As in any fire, wear a self-contained breathing apparatus in pressure-demand, MSHA/NIOSH (approved or equivalent), and full protective gear. During a fire, irritating and highly toxic gases may be generated by thermal decomposition or combustion.
Extinguishing Media: Use agent most appropriate to extinguish fire. 
Handling: Wash thoroughly after handling. Remove contaminated clothing and wash before reuse. Avoid contact with eyes, skin, and clothing. Avoid ingestion and inhalation.
Storage: Store in a cool, dry place. Keep container closed when not in use.
